Full job description
The Radiology Technologist 2 participates in technical duties directly involved with all modalities in which they are registered including developing, initiating, and monitoring procedures for the effective utilization of the units. The Radiology Technologist 2 actively participates in outstanding customer service and accepts responsibility in maintaining relationships that are equally respectful to all. Facilitates the smooth operation of the department by performing a broad range of duties. Receives and processes paperwork; maintains on-going departmental records, performs exams according to policy while assuring patient safety, comfort and protection, assists radiologist and attending physician, communicates effectively and appropriately, works efficiently and productively, maintains a clean and safe environment by demonstrating proper use and care of equipment, reflects a caring attitude for patients, visitors, and employees and stays abreast of changes through continuing education programs. Other duties as assigned. On call shifts required at the discretion of the Radiology Director. All duties are performed in accordance with established policies and procedures.
Education
Radiology Technologist Program
License
Radiology Technologist
Certification
American Registry of Radiologic Technologists (ARRT) Registered
Basic Life Support (BLS) through American Heart Association or American Red Cross
Tampa General is a private not-for-profit hospital and one of the most comprehensive medical facilities in West Central Florida serving a dozen counties with a population in excess of 4 million. As one of the largest hospitals in Florida, Tampa General is licensed for 982 beds, and with over 15,000 team members, is one of the region’s largest employers.
Consistently recognized for world-class care, Tampa General Hospital is ranked as the #1 hospital in Tampa Bay by U.S. News & World Report for 2024-25 and is nationally ranked as among the top 50 hospitals in the nation in eight specialties. Additionally, Tampa General was ranked as “high performing,” or among the top 10% of hospitals in the nation, in five more specialties along with 12 procedures and conditions.
TGH partners with the USF Health Morsani College of Medicine to pioneer breakthrough treatments, conduct game-changing clinical research and train the next generation of health care professionals. TGH is the region's only academic health system, having been affiliated with the USF Health Morsani College of Medicine since the school was created in the early 1970s.
TGH is the area’s only Level I trauma center and one of two ABA-verified Adult & Pediatric burn centers in Florida. With five medical helicopters, we are able to transport critically injured or ill patients from 23 surrounding counties to receive the advanced care they need. The hospital is home to the leading organ transplant center in the country, having performed more than 14,000 adult solid organ transplants, including the state’s first successful heart transplant in 1985. Tampa General Hospital is committed to serving all residents of West Central Florida. We provide comprehensive health services, ranging from wellness and primary care to the most complex specialty care and post-acute services.
